1. Foundations of AR and App Updates in Digital Ecosystems

a. Defining augmented reality: core principles and technological prerequisites

Augmented reality (AR) overlays digital content onto the physical world through devices like smartphones, tablets, or AR glasses. Its core principles involve real-time interaction, spatial awareness, and seamless integration of virtual elements with the environment. Technological prerequisites include sensors such as cameras, accelerometers, and gyroscopes, as well as processing power and sophisticated software frameworks like ARKit (Apple) or ARCore (Google). These enable precise tracking, rendering, and interaction, making AR a transformative tool across industries.

2. How Augmented Reality Transforms User Experiences

a. Enhancing interactivity and immersion in mobile applications

AR transforms traditional user interactions by adding layers of interactivity and immersion. Instead of passive consumption, users actively engage with virtual objects integrated into their real-world environment. For instance, educational apps utilize AR to project 3D models of molecules or historical artifacts, making learning more engaging. b. Examples of AR in education, gaming, retail, and social media

Sector Example
Education AR apps showing 3D models of the human body for anatomy lessons
Gaming AR-based games like Pokémon GO that bring virtual creatures into real-world settings
Retail Virtual try-ons for clothing or furniture using AR
Social Media Filters and AR effects enhancing photos and videos

5. Privacy and Security in AR and App Updates

a. Addressing user data concerns with privacy-focused features

As AR applications often collect sensitive data like location, camera feed, and environmental mapping, privacy becomes a critical concern. Incorporating features such as “Sign in with Apple” or transparent data policies during updates reassures users. Developers must prioritize secure data handling to foster trust and comply with regulations like GDPR.

b. The role of secure update mechanisms in maintaining user confidence

Secure update processes prevent malicious injections and data breaches, which are especially damaging in AR environments where real-world data is involved. Implementing encrypted channels, code signing, and regular security patches during updates are essential practices that uphold user trust and protect sensitive information.

c. Future privacy considerations in AR content delivery

Looking ahead, privacy in AR will require innovations such as on-device processing, anonymization techniques, and user-controlled data sharing. As AR becomes more pervasive, developers and regulators must collaborate to establish standards that protect user rights without hindering technological advancement.
